About This Access Site
Standard Put In at Wolf Creek is a whitewater access point on the Hiwassee River in Polk County, Tennessee. This is a popular launch spot for paddlers looking to run whitewater sections of the Hiwassee. The put-in provides access to one of Tennessee's notable whitewater rivers, which offers varying difficulty depending on water levels and the specific section being paddled. Located in the scenic mountain terrain of Southeast Tennessee, this access point serves as a gateway for kayakers and canoeists seeking whitewater experiences.
